Vault is a private journaling and emotional processing app. The core promise: complete privacy, zero judgment, no clinical language.
The AI companion talks like a trusted friend — direct, real, no corporate wellness speak. You journal privately first. You build trust. Then — only if you want to — it can help connect you with someone. On your terms. At your pace.
🔒
Zero Data Storage
All entries are encrypted on your device using AES-256. The encryption key never leaves your device. Not even we can read it.
🤝
AI That Talks Like a Friend
No clinical language. No diagnoses. No "have you tried gratitude journaling." Just real, direct conversation from something that actually listens.
🌉
Soft Therapy Bridge
After consistent use, if heavy patterns emerge, the AI gently asks once if you'd want to talk to someone. If you say no — it never brings it up again.
📋
The Brief
If you ever want to see a professional, Vault generates a session summary so your first appointment starts somewhere real — not at square one.
🎖️
Veteran Mode
Verified via ID.me. Free forever, no questions asked. The AI switches to a direct, no-nonsense voice — full respect for the "handle your own shit" mentality.
🤜
Battle Buddy
Verified veterans can opt into peer matching. The app connects two vets based on service era and what they're processing. Anonymous. In-app. Real.

The Compound
But Vault is just the beginning.
The long-term vision is physical communities in all 50 states. Real homes for displaced veterans and homeless individuals. Not shelters. Not programs. Homes — with dignity built into the architecture.
🏠
Residential BuildingsPrivate rooms and shared spaces for residents.
🛡️
Veteran-Staffed SecurityEmployment and community in one. Veterans protecting veterans.
📚
On-Site SchoolsGED programs, vocational training, life skills — inside the compound.
🛒
Community StoreGrocery and convenience — operated by and for residents.
🧠
Mental Health CenterTherapists, psychologists, counselors on site. No commute. No barrier.
🏥
Medical ClinicBasic healthcare without leaving. Healthcare is a right, not a privilege.
💼
Job Training & PlacementReal skills, real jobs, real futures. Not just a roof — a path forward.
🤝
Community SpacesRecreation, gathering, connection. Because community is what heals.
The Path
This is how we get there.
1
Build revenue apps that people actually need. Real products solving real problems. Every subscription funds the mission.
2
File the 501(c)(3) nonprofit. Under $500 to do it ourselves. No excuses. The paperwork is already mapped.
3
Launch Vault — free for everyone. The mental health app ships under the nonprofit umbrella the moment the filing is approved.
4
Apply for VA grants, federal health tech grants, foundation funding. The VA Grant and Per Diem Program. SAMHSA. Bob Woodruff Foundation. The money exists.
5
Break ground on the first compound. One facility. One state. Proof of concept. Document everything.
6
Do it again in every state. The blueprint scales. The mission doesn't stop until there are 50.
